12. Determination of Thorium (IV) in Presence of Micellar Medium by Derivative Spectrophotometric Technique

ABSTRACT

A simple and sensitive spectrophotometric method has been developed for determination of thorium (IV) using newly synthesized 3-methoxysalcilaldehyde-4-hydroxybenzoylhydrazone (MSHBH) reagent in a micellar medium of Triton X -100 (neutral surfactant). Thorium (IV) forms a yellow coloured water soluble complex with the reagent in acidic buffer medium pH 4.25. Beer’s law obeyed in the range 0.232 to 4.641 μg/ml of          Th (IV) λmax at 394 nm. The molar absorptivity and Sandell’s sensitivity of coloured species are 2.0 x 104 l.mol-1.cm-1 and 0.012 μg/cm2 respectively. Thorium (IV) forms (M: L) 1:1 complex and stability constant of the complex is 1.95 x 105. The developed derivative spectrophotometric method was employed for the determination of thorium (IV) in monazite sand.
